Did NY A 9180 pass?

Not yet. NY A 9180 is in committee as of 2026-05-07 and has not come to a final vote. Latest recorded action (2026-05-07): PRINT NUMBER 9180A

What is NY A 9180 about?

Authorizes the assessor of the town of Babylon to accept from Christian Congregation of Long Island an application for exemption from real property taxes with respect to the 2023-2024 assessment rolls.

Who sponsors NY A 9180?

Kwani O'Pharrow is the primary sponsor of NY A 9180.
